This unit introduces the basics of VR technology, its applications, and the benefits of using VR in property maintenance. It covers the history of VR, types of VR headsets, and the hardware and software requirements for a VR experience. • Property Inspection and Surveying in VR
This unit focuses on the application of VR in property inspection and surveying. It covers the use of VR to create 3D models of properties, measure spaces, and identify defects. It also discusses the importance of accuracy and precision in VR-based property inspections. • Virtual Reality Training for Property Maintenance
This unit explores the use of VR in training property maintenance personnel. It covers the development of VR training programs, the use of VR to simulate real-world scenarios, and the benefits of VR-based training for property maintenance. • 3D Modeling and Animation for Property Maintenance
This unit introduces the principles of 3D modeling and animation, and their applications in property maintenance. It covers the use of 3D modeling software, texturing, and lighting, and the creation of 3D models of properties and components. • Virtual Reality Maintenance Planning and Scheduling
This unit focuses on the use of VR in maintenance planning and scheduling. It covers the use of VR to create 3D models of properties, identify maintenance needs, and develop maintenance schedules. It also discusses the benefits of VR-based maintenance planning and scheduling. • Augmented Reality (AR) for Property Maintenance
This unit introduces the basics of AR technology and its applications in property maintenance. It covers the use of AR to overlay digital information onto the real world, and the benefits of AR for property maintenance, including improved accuracy and reduced costs. • Property Maintenance Management in VR
This unit explores the use of VR in property maintenance management. It covers the use of VR to manage maintenance operations, track progress, and monitor performance. It also discusses the benefits of VR-based property maintenance management, including improved efficiency and reduced costs. • Virtual Reality Quality Control and Assurance
This unit focuses on the use of VR in quality control and assurance in property maintenance. It covers the use of VR to inspect properties, identify defects, and ensure quality. It also discusses the benefits of VR-based quality control and assurance, including improved accuracy and reduced costs. • Virtual Reality Collaboration and Communication
This unit introduces the use of VR in collaboration and communication in property maintenance. It covers the use of VR to facilitate communication between maintenance personnel, property owners, and contractors, and the benefits of VR-based collaboration and communication, including improved efficiency and reduced costs. • Virtual Reality for Energy Efficiency and Sustainability
This unit explores the use of VR in energy efficiency and sustainability in property maintenance. It covers the use of VR to analyze energy usage, identify areas for improvement, and develop strategies for energy efficiency and sustainability. It also discusses the benefits of VR-based energy efficiency and sustainability, including reduced energy costs and environmental benefits.
